Madhupur - Banekuchi, Nalbari

Madhupur is a village situated in the Banekuchi subdivision of Nalbari district, Assam. It is located approximately 18 km from Nalbari, which serves as both the tehsil and district headquarters. 38 No. Kaithalkuchi Jowardi serves as the Gram Panchayat for Madhupur village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Madhupur is 303986. The village covers a total geographical area of 144.99 hectares and falls under the 781346 pincode. Nalbari is the nearest town, located about 8 km away.

Madhupur village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Dharmapur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Barpeta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Madhupur

As per Census 2011, Madhupur village has a total population of 1,154 people, consisting of 588 males and 566 females. The village has 224 households and a sex ratio of 962 females per 1,000 males. There are 126 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 811 literate and 343 illiterate residents. Additionally, 189 people belong to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.
